Coated graphite is formed by attaching coating materials (such as silicon carbide, tantalum carbide, etc.) to a graphite substrate of a specific shape. The coating material wraps the graphite substrate to form a protective layer with excellent properties such as density, high temperature resistance, and oxidation resistance. Coated graphite for semiconductors is a semiconductor consumable, mainly used in single crystal growth equipment, MOCVD and compound semiconductor epitaxial equipment, etc.
